Sweden’s Fjällmaraton 100k is fifth stop for Spartan Trail World Championship

The Spartan Trail World Championship (STWC), in its fifth stop, is moving to Åre, in central Sweden. The mountain village with just over 12,000 inhabitants is the home of the Kia Fjällmaraton.

Held between July 29th and August 5th, runners will contest eight distances (half marathon, vertical kilometre, 8k, 2x 12k, 27k, 45k and 100k) in a trail festival in the northern Scandinavian fjords.

As part of the ULTRA championship of the Spartan Trail World Championship, the 100k (which will also award 4 ITRA points) starts on Thursday, August 3rd, where more than 130 trail runners will run 6,200m of elevation gain on rugged trails, surrounded by forests.

The Kia Fjällmaraton, which this year will celebrates its 19th anniversary, hopes to create an atmosphere in the finish area with the public invited to cheer on the runners. Alongside the Spartan Trail World Championship, the Ottsjö 8K also takes place. Participants and spectators will also be able to take in live music and sample traditional food.

The Spartan Trail World Championship (STWC) is a global championship with multiple stops around the world. Each race in the world championship has multiple distances, with two selected to score in the final STWC ranking.

The STWC features two simultaneous championships – an ULTRA championship (distances of 50km or more) and a TRAIL championship (distances up to 49km).

The 2023 season started in February with Transgrancanaria, followed by the Patagonia Run in the southern hemisphere, and continuing with Maxi-Race Annecy in the heart of the Alps. The series also recently had a stop in the tropical rainforest of the Brisbane Trail Ultra.

Now, in the heart of the European summer, the Spartan Trail World Championship moves to Sweden. Kia Fjällmaraton Årefjällen, billed as Sweden’s most prestigious mountain race, offers the chance to be part of STWC 2023 with the Kia Fjällmaraton 45K for the TRAIL category and the 100k race for the ULTRA category.

The 2023 season will have nine events worldwide, each offering points for the final ranking of the championship. Upcoming races include Salomon Ultra Pirineu, Borneo Trail Classic, Shinshiro Trail Classic and Golden Gate Trail Classic.

The STWC will have cash prizes for the overall rankings in both the male and female categories.
